Teen Dies In Ellicott City Crash: Police

The accident along Route 108 shut down the road for three hours in both directions.

ELLICOTT CITY, MD — A serious collision along Route 108 at Manorstone Lane Feb. 25 shortly after 4 p.m. led to the death of a 17-year-old teenager. The road was closed for three hoursin both directions.

According to the Howard County Police Department, the driver of a 2001 Chevrolet Impala was traveling eastbound on Route 108 when he crossed the center line and struck a 2016 Lexus SUV headed westbound. The driver and sole occupant of the Impala, Marc Ryan El-Sayed, 17, of Clarksville, was pronounced dead at the scene.

The driver and sole occupant of the SUV, Susie Lee Yang, 48, of Highland, was transported to the University of Maryland Shock Trauma Center with non-life-threatening injuries. The cause of the collision remains under investigation.
